Women’s weight and well-being: Why we have to settle for the pregnant physique as a valued feminine type

Societal pressures to keep up the perfect feminine physique could also be heightened throughout being pregnant. (Pexels/Ryutaro Tsukata)

Pregnancy is a definite life stage characterised by dramatic physiological adjustments, and medical monitoring of these adjustments, together with weight acquire, is routine to watch the well being of the mom and the growing toddler. What could also be lacking from weight monitoring is the psychological and emotional element of those adjustments.

Western society tends to view the feminine physique as an object that ought to be continuously inspected and evaluated, and valued for its utility and talent to offer pleasure. Women may ascribe to those notions, partaking in fixed self-inspection and analysis of their very own our bodies by way of the method of self-objectification.

A lady’s skill to fulfill societal requirements for the feminine physique generally is a supply of energy, and any deviation from the perfect bodily type can lead to a lack of energy. Exercise, eating regimen or a mix of each are sometimes seen as instruments girls can use to regulate their our bodies to realize and preserve the perfect feminine type.

The skill to successfully management one’s physique form, dimension and look is seen as an accomplishment. Women who miss the mark — those that are unsuccessful in controlling their our bodies — might be affected each bodily and emotionally. These girls might present indicators of despair, disordered consuming, unfavorable physique picture and low libido.

Given the ubiquity of physique objectification, these psychological repercussions can type a part of girls’s day by day lives.

Body picture in being pregnant

Societal pressures to keep up the perfect feminine physique could also be heightened throughout being pregnant. As girls negotiate their new roles as mothers-to-be, earlier analysis has proven that girls report reasonable declines in physique picture and physique satisfaction as being pregnant progresses.

Interviews with younger moms exploring their experiences of weight acquire throughout their first being pregnant revealed a view of the pregnant physique that’s distinct from the perfect feminine physique. This falls into the bigger context of how femininity is seen: that girls’s worth lies of their look and talent to offer start.

In this attitude, the pregnant physique just isn’t solely distinct from the perfect feminine physique, however intentionally conflicts with the view of the perfect feminine physique as an aesthetic object. The pregnant physique remains to be monitored and evaluated, however emphasis is positioned on its utility and reproductive position.

Previous evaluation of particular person and group interviews with younger moms, together with examination of booklets and handouts given to pregnant girls, confirmed discussions round being pregnant and childbirth are sometimes filtered by way of a medical lens.

This medical context has been described as lowering girls’s energy over their pregnant our bodies by assuming girls are much less emotionally competent throughout being pregnant and are unable to make correct choices for themselves about their our bodies. It necessitates a separation between girls’s minds and their our bodies, and prioritizes the growing toddler.

While medicalized monitoring throughout being pregnant focuses on bodily well being, psychosocial evaluation could also be uncared for.

Soon after being pregnant, girls typically use restricted consuming and structured train to attempt to craft their our bodies again into the societal ultimate of a lean feminine type. If potential, they could attempt to stay near this type throughout being pregnant.

A pregnant lady’s fixation on needing to return to pre-pregnancy weight might meet the factors for potential presence of physique dysmorphia and elevated danger for disordered consuming.

When girls regularly monitor and consider their our bodies for deviations from the perfect feminine type, their well-being can develop into largely depending on their bodily look. This can additional end in decrease psychological functioning and minimization of their lived experiences.

Defining psychosocial objectives

While medicalized monitoring throughout being pregnant has carried out properly to deal with bodily improvement of each mom and toddler, psychosocial evaluation could also be a uncared for a part of this course of.

There are outlined psychosocial adjustment objectives for a number of life levels. For instance, rising adults are inspired to develop into impartial, given area for id formation, and are nudged in direction of leaving the parental dwelling. Older adults are inspired to simply accept the character and extent of the bodily and emotional adjustments related to getting older, in addition to adjustments in id as these relate to household and profession.

Similarly, outlining of psychosocial adjustment objectives for being pregnant would empower girls of their acceptance of their physique’s bodily adjustments, and the way these differ from societal expectations of the perfect feminine type. As the extent of self-objectification is tracked throughout being pregnant, pregnant girls might be inspired to maneuver from physique dysmorphia in direction of physique acceptance.

This might assist set up optimistic behaviours through which meals is used for consolation and nourishment, and structured bodily exercise is as a lot an fulfilling endeavour as a method in direction of bettering well being.
